When changing the default language of a server it is neccessary to run sp_defaultlangauge against any existing logins. The reason is default language only effects any new accounts created after this change is made. This script is designed to help you quickly make the adjustment for all existing accounts. This UDF parses a comma delimited string and returns a table with the parse strings as rows. Usage: select * from fn+PareseString('12,13,14,67')Will return a table with the following rows12131467Can be modified to have an additional parameter for the type of delimiter.
